Abstract

This study screened microRNAs (miRNAs) that are abnormally expressed in papillary thyroid carcinoma (PTC) tissues to identify PTC and nodular goiter and the degree of PTC malignancy. A total of 51 thyroid tumor tissue specimens paired with adjacent normal thyroid tissues were obtained from the Department of Surgical Oncology of Hangzhou First People's Hospital from June-December 2011. miRNA expression profiles were examined by microarrays and validated by quantitative real-time PCR (qRT-PCR). Expression levels of the miRNAs were analyzed to assess if they were associated with selected clinicopathological features. Eleven miRNAs were significantly differentially expressed between nodular goiter and PTC and between highly invasive and low invasive PTC. miR-199b-5p and miR-30a-3p were significantly differentially expressed among the three groups. miR-30a-3p, miR-122-5p, miR-136-5p, miR-146b-5p and miR-199b-5p were selected for further study by qRT-PCR and miR-146b-5p, miR-199b-5p and miR-30a-3p were different between the PTC and nodular goiter groups. miR-199b-5p was over-expressed in PTC patients with extrathyroidal invasion and cervical lymph node metastasis. In conclusion miR-146b-5p, miR-30a-3p, and miR-199b-5p may serve as biomarkers for the diagnosis of PTC and miR-199b-5p is associated with PTC invasiveness.

摘要

本研究筛选了在甲状腺乳头状癌(PTC)组织中异常表达的微小RNA(miRNA),以鉴别PTC与结节性甲状腺肿以及PTC的恶性程度。2011年6月至12月期间,从杭州市第一人民医院外科肿瘤科获取了51例甲状腺肿瘤组织标本及其配对的相邻正常甲状腺组织。通过微阵列检测miRNA表达谱,并通过定量实时聚合酶链反应(qRT-PCR)进行验证。分析miRNA的表达水平,以评估它们是否与选定的临床病理特征相关。在结节性甲状腺肿与PTC之间以及高侵袭性和低侵袭性PTC之间,有11种miRNA存在显著差异表达。miR-199b-5p和miR-30a-3p在三组之间存在显著差异表达。通过qRT-PCR选择miR-30a-3p、miR-122-5p、miR-136-5p、miR-146b-5p和miR-199b-5p进行进一步研究,且miR-146b-5p、miR-199b-5p和miR-30a-3p在PTC组和结节性甲状腺肿组之间存在差异。miR-199b-5p在伴有甲状腺外侵犯和颈部淋巴结转移的PTC患者中过度表达。总之,miR-146b-5p、miR-30a-3p和miR-199b-5p可能作为PTC诊断的生物标志物,且miR-199b-5p与PTC的侵袭性相关。
